83. Deputy Jennifer Murnane O'Connor asked the Minister for Children, Equality, Disability, Integration and Youth how the funding increase for his Department announced in budget 2024 will provide for an expansion of targeted access and inclusion model, AIM, supports to children in County Carlow beyond time spent in the early childhood care and education, ECCE, programme, both in term and out of term;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[55524/23]
